Cognitive Stimulation
Cognitive Stimulation includes activities designed to keep the mind active and engaged, supporting skills such as memory, attention, language, problem-solving, and reasoning.
For people living with dementia or cognitive impairment, these activities can help maintain mental abilities for longer, boost confidence, and encourage social interaction. The focus is on enjoyment and meaningful engagement rather than “getting the right answer”.
Activities can be adapted to different abilities and interests, and may include conversation prompts, reminiscence, puzzles, games, music, and creative tasks.

Sensory Stimulation
Sensory Stimulation includes activities and products designed to engage the senses — touch, sight, sound, smell, and sometimes taste — to promote calm, comfort, and connection.
For people living with dementia or sensory needs, sensory stimulation can help reduce anxiety, ease agitation, improve mood, and encourage interaction with the world around them. It’s especially helpful when words are harder to find, as sensory experiences can feel familiar and reassuring.
Items and activities can be tailored to the individual and may include tactile fidget products, textured fabrics, light and colour effects, music and sound, aromatherapy, and soothing hand or massage tools.

Creative Activities
Creative Activities provide opportunities for self-expression through art, music, and imaginative play, allowing individuals to explore ideas and emotions in a relaxed and enjoyable way.
For people living with dementia, creative activities can help boost confidence, reduce anxiety, and offer a sense of achievement without pressure or right-or-wrong outcomes. They often tap into long-held abilities and interests, even as other skills change.
Activities may include painting, drawing, colouring, crafts, music-making, singing, storytelling, and other creative projects that can be enjoyed individually or shared with others.

Comfort & Fidget
Comfort & Fidget products are designed to provide reassurance, calm, and gentle sensory engagement through touch and movement.
For people living with dementia, anxiety, or restlessness, these items can help reduce stress, ease agitation, and offer a comforting focus for busy or unsettled hands. They can also provide a sense of familiarity and emotional security.
Items may include fidget cushions, sensory blankets, soft toys, textured objects, hand-held fidgets, and comforting fabrics, all intended to be soothing, safe, and easy to use.

Physical & Movement
Physical & Movement activities encourage gentle exercise and movement to help maintain mobility, coordination, and overall wellbeing.
For people living with dementia or reduced mobility, regular physical activity can support strength, balance, circulation, and mood. Activities are designed to be safe, adaptable, and enjoyable, focusing on ability rather than limitation.
Activities may include light exercise, stretching, ball games, movement to music, seated activities, and simple coordination tasks that promote confidence and participation.

Companionship & Emotional Support
Companionship & Emotional Support focuses on providing comfort, reassurance, and a sense of connection through presence, interaction, and familiar routines.
For people living with dementia, loneliness and anxiety can be significant challenges. Companionship and emotionally supportive activities can help reduce distress, improve mood, and promote feelings of safety, belonging, and self-worth.
This may include companion dolls or pets, one-to-one interaction, reminiscence and conversation, calming routines, and products designed to offer emotional reassurance and a comforting sense of connection.

Social & Group Games
Social & Group Games are activities designed to encourage interaction, communication, and shared enjoyment with others, whether in small groups or larger social settings.
For people living with dementia, these games can help reduce feelings of isolation, support social skills, and create opportunities for laughter, connection, and meaningful engagement. The emphasis is on participation and enjoyment rather than competition or winning.
Games can be adapted to different abilities and group sizes, and may include simple board games, card games, quizzes, conversation starters, team activities, and group-based memory or word games.
